Socialization
Dogs that don't have much possibility to mingle or exercise frequently can come to be distressed and destructive. A well-run daycare facility supplies a secure environment where canines can communicate with various other pets while being seen by trained staff. This can help to minimize anxiousness and construct self-confidence in your pet dog, minimizing behavior troubles in the house such as barking or eating.
A good dog daycare will separate canines by dimension, personality and play design to stay clear of needlessly hostile communications. The staff should observe canine interactions very carefully and interfere if essential. They will certainly likewise make note of just how your pet connects with various other pets and adjust playgroups as necessary.

Workout
Canines need regular physical exercise to keep their muscles and joints healthy. Childcare centers supply a selection of tasks to offer your puppy the exercise they need. They may play fetch video games, go through challenge programs, and even take part in group play with other canines. Canines that get enough physical activity will be much more unwinded and less likely to act out because of monotony or anxiety when they are left alone at home.
Additionally, some pet daycare centers also offer psychological excitement to keep your pet's mind sharp. This can include puzzle toys, training sessions, or other interactive video games. These tasks can protect against dullness from arising, which subsequently can avoid harmful actions like chewing or excessive barking.

Training
If your dog struggles with separation anxiety, a day care center can help. A pet that attends childcare frequently will be worn out by the end of the day and is much less likely to exhibit annoying or harmful behaviors when left home alone.
When picking a canine childcare, inquire about their staff-to-dog ratio and day-to-day routine and timetable. Credible facilities will certainly have a low staff-to-dog proportion to make sure adequate guidance and safety. They need to also have a clear inoculation policy and implement guidelines concerning flea and tick prevention.

Try to find a daycare that abides by neighborhood health and safety laws, is in close closeness to your home or office, and provides extra services like grooming or training. Inquire about the staff-to-dog ratio and if they call for canines to be approximately date on their vaccinations.
Social pets who take pleasure in running could do well in a childcare with big indoor play rooms. Nonetheless, if your pet dog is afraid or anxious around other pets, they could do better in a various kind of daycare setup. Make certain to ask the daycare what they will do if your dog exhibits inappropriate behaviors during their trial period. Stay clear of any kind of childcare that makes use of aversives or dominance-based strategies to take care of actions.
